- The distance between Thomasville, Al, Usa and Bintulu, Malaysia is approximately 15,515 km or 9,641 mi.
- To reach Thomasville, Al in this distance one would set out from Bintulu bearing 28°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Thomasville, Al bearing 146.5° or SSE .
- Thomasville, Al has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Bintulu has a tropical rainforest climate (Af).
- Thomasville, Al is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Bintulu is in or near the subtropical wet for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 8.8 °C (15.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 18.4 °C (33.1°F) more in Thomasville, Al.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2263.2 mm (89.1 in) less which is equivalent to 2263.2 l/m² (55.54 US gal/ft²) or 22,632,000 l/ha (2,419,511 US gal/ac) less. About 2/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 16.6° lower in Thomasville, Al than in Bintulu.
